Pinned Repositories
cfgrammar-tool
Work with context-free grammars. Parsing, string generation, and manipulation.
dfa-lib
JavaScript tools for working with DFAs and NFAs. Focuses on manipulation and analysis of automata, not their use.
magic-wormhole-js
WIP port of magic-wormhole to JavaScript
matrix-archive-bot
bot to log matrix channels
MenuBarVolume
trivial app for Macs to show volume in menu bar even when using headphones
SlateStarComments
The thing which highlights new comments on Slate Star Codex posts
test262-web-runner
Run test262 in a browser
unix-socket-protobuf
Protocol Buffers over Unix domain sockets - a toy implementation in three languages
shift-spec
:fast_forward: Shift AST Specification
ecma262
Status, process, and documents for ECMA-262
bakkot's Repositories
bakkot/test262-web-runner
Run test262 in a browser
bakkot/do-expressions-v2
bakkot/npm-zig
zig distributed on npm
bakkot/cookie
HTTP server cookie parsing and serialization
bakkot/grammarkdown
Markdown-like DSL for defining grammatical syntax for programming languages.
bakkot/jsdom
A JavaScript implementation of various web standards, for use with Node.js
bakkot/salvation
Parse Content Security Policy headers, warn about policy errors, safely manipulate, render, and optimise policies
bakkot/self-deploying-repo
A GitHub repo which updates its own pages branch whenever pushed
bakkot/tantivy-wasm
bakkot/astexplorer
A web tool to explore the ASTs generated by various parsers.
bakkot/bakkot.github.io
bakkot/deno_lint
Blazing fast linter for JavaScript and TypeScript written in Rust
bakkot/ecma262
Status, process, and documents for ECMA262
bakkot/ecma262-fork
Like the JS spec, but without the spec
bakkot/eshost-cli
Run ECMAScript code uniformly across any ECMAScript host
bakkot/gh-pages-search-test
bakkot/proposal-array-from-async
Draft specification for a proposed Array.fromAsync method in JavaScript.
bakkot/proposal-array-grouping
A proposal to make grouping of array items easier
bakkot/proposal-do-expressions
Proposal for `do` expressions
bakkot/proposal-integer
Arbitrary precision integers in JavaScript
bakkot/proposal-weakrefs
WeakRefs
bakkot/sql.js-httpvfs
bakkot/streams
Streams Standard
bakkot/tc39-ci
Begin app
bakkot/trust-token-api
Trust Token API
bakkot/volta
Volta: JS Toolchains as Code. ⚡
bakkot/webappsec-csp
WebAppSec Content Security Policy
bakkot/whatwg.org
The WHATWG website and other static resources
bakkot/z3-js-bindings
WIP bindings for the Z3 solver in JS
bakkot/z3-unknown-repro
reproduction for an issue with the wasm build of z3